Worcester Chambers, Heritage building in Christchurch Central City, New Zealand.
The Worcester Chambers occupies a three-story structure at 69 Worcester Street, featuring Georgian revival architecture with red brick and stone elements.
Cecil Wood designed this Category II heritage building in 1926, and construction finished in 1927, initially housing Digby's Commercial College, a secretarial school.
The building represents the architectural evolution of Christchurch's commercial district, integrating Georgian revival elements into the urban landscape of the 1920s.
The structure underwent seismic reinforcement in 2007, which proved effective during the Canterbury earthquakes of 2010 and 2011.
Worcester Chambers changed ownership multiple times, including a brief period as Gough Chambers, before selling for 2.18 million New Zealand dollars in 2016.
